# Lina Lee > Software Engineer Location: New York, New York, United States Profile: https://flows.cv/linalee Empathetic software engineer with specialty in JavaScript, React, and Node. Actively contributing to open-source solution-driven tools, focused on improving client experience. Most recently worked on Chromogen, a test generator and debugging tool for React/Recoil apps with a companion dev tool. Featured speaker for the Single Sprout Speaker Series - Proxies: CORS Check out Chromogen: https://chromogen.dev/ 👩‍💻 Find me on GitHub: https://github.com/lina4lee ## Work Experience ### Software Engineer @ Blueberry Medical Jan 2022 – Present ### Software Engineer @ Codesmith Jan 2022 – Jan 2023 | Santa Monica, California, United States • Expanded test coverage by writing unit tests using Jest and integration tests using React Testing Library to ensure expected user experience and proper functionality of Redux action dispatches and React components • Implemented socket.io’s WebSocket protocol to establish a real-time, event-driven communication in an in-browser collaborative IDE • Conducted technical interviews for prospective engineers with a focus on assessing proficiency in technical communication, empathetic engineering, and analytical problem solving using advanced JavaScript concepts, including recursion and closure • Mentored junior developers by conducting one-on-one code review, guiding design discussions, and providing lectures on core web development concepts to reinforce best practices and promote personal development ### Software Engineer @ Chromogen (Open Source) Jan 2022 – Jan 2023 • Employed TypeScript’s strict typing and interfaces to catch errors at compile-time for codebase maintainability and scalability • Built React architecture to leverage dynamic component rendering and flux model to establish a consistent and readable codebase as well as minimize unnecessary rerendering, improving overall performance and UX • Implemented Jest as the default testing framework for its lightweight parallel testing and out-of-the-box auto-mocking features and React and Recoil hooks testing library to support client-side integration of Chromogen • Applied Recoil.js atoms, selectors, and families to observe state at every render to generate meaningful and syntactically-sound test files for developers • Utilized D3 to create an interactive and declarative state visualization tree that tracks state changes and component relational hierarchy to improve the debugging experience for users • Applied Chrome runtime and messaging API to render live customized test files on companion DevTool to allow for easy testing • Employed Webhooks and automated tests of Travis CI to reduce the risk of integration errors at development and enable secure and seamless updates as the application scales • Designed a splash page using Next.js to optimize render and load time via dynamic client-side rendering through automated code-splitting • Product developed and maintained under tech accelerator OS Labs ### Escape Date | emergency text alerting app to improve offline safety in online dating @ Open Source Jan 2022 – Jan 2022 • Leveraged React’s unidirectional data flow and reusable components and Redux’s flux-like architecture to improve maintainability and performance, allowing scalability and enhancing consistency • Generated Jest unit tests to implement Test-Driven Development for optimal reliability and consistency in the codebase • Developed static routes using React Router to reduce overall network requests and improve user experience by optimizing load time with a single page application • Applied React Hooks to dynamically reuse stateful logic while retaining component hierarchy and a uniform codebase of functional components for enhanced readability and ease of testing • Utilized Express.js middleware paradigm in building a RESTful server to efficiently manage HTTP/API calls with routers and controllers in organized endpoints • Architected a PostgreSQL database to securely store relational data, leveraging its ACID compliance to allow for timely data transaction • Incorporated third-party SMS API in building an SOS texting feature for subtle and quick alerting of emergency contacts with a single button click ### RxMember | prescription and OTC medication refill reminder app @ Open Source Jan 2022 – Jan 2022 • Developed static routes using React Router for frontend optimization by implementing lazy-loading in building a single page application to reduce server traffic and render time, improving UI/UX • Utilized NoSQL database to store patient-specific medication lists in nested documents for improved speed, flexibility, and scalability ## Education ### Bachelor of Science - BS University of Southern California ### Master of Science - MS in Global Medicine Keck School of Medicine of the University of Southern California ## Contact & Social - LinkedIn: https://linkedin.com/in/lee-lina --- Source: https://flows.cv/linalee JSON Resume: https://flows.cv/linalee/resume.json Last updated: 2026-03-29